What does the term rectifier mean?

An electrical device that converts alternating current to direct current is known as a rectifier. An inverter is a device that converts direct current to alternating current.

How many diodes in a bridge rectifier?

Bridge Rectifier DiodesIn a "bridge" rectifier there is 4 diodes In a "full wave" there are 2 diodes.In a "half wave" rectifier there is 1 diode.

How can capacitor smooth or reduce the ripple of the voltage produced by the rectifier?

when rectifier is on, the capacitor is almost transparent (it charges to the voltage provided from the rectifier) when rectifier is off, capacitor holds the peak voltage since it stored a charge during rectifier on time.
